NNSMS如何实现多协议支持?
在当今信息化时代,网络通信技术的发展日新月异,多协议支持成为网络设备的核心功能之一。NNSMS作为一款优秀的网络管理系统,如何实现多协议支持,成为了许多用户关注的焦点。本文将深入探讨NNSMS的多协议支持机制,帮助读者全面了解其技术优势。
一、NNSMS简介
NNSMS(Network Network Management System)是一款基于Java架构的网络管理系统,具有高性能、高可靠性、易扩展等特点。它能够对多种网络设备进行统一管理,支持多种协议,满足不同场景下的网络管理需求。
二、NNSMS多协议支持机制
NNSMS的多协议支持主要基于以下几个机制:
协议栈抽象化:NNSMS采用协议栈抽象化技术,将不同协议的底层实现封装成统一的接口,使得上层应用无需关心具体协议的细节,从而简化了多协议支持的实现过程。
插件式设计:NNSMS采用插件式设计,将不同协议的实现作为插件加载到系统中。当需要支持新的协议时,只需开发相应的插件即可,无需修改系统核心代码,提高了系统的可扩展性。
协议适配器:NNSMS提供协议适配器功能,用于实现不同协议之间的转换。例如,当需要将SNMP协议的数据转换为CMIP协议时,只需通过协议适配器即可完成转换。
协议解析器:NNSMS内置多种协议解析器,能够解析各种网络设备的协议数据。这些解析器遵循相应的协议规范,确保数据的准确性。
三、NNSMS多协议支持的优势
降低开发成本:NNSMS的多协议支持机制简化了网络管理系统的开发过程,降低了开发成本。
提高系统性能:NNSMS采用高效的协议栈抽象化技术,使得系统在处理多协议数据时具有更高的性能。
增强系统可扩展性:NNSMS的插件式设计和协议适配器功能,使得系统可以轻松扩展新的协议支持。
提高数据准确性:NNSMS内置多种协议解析器,确保了数据的准确性。
四、案例分析
以下是一个NNSMS多协议支持的案例分析:
某企业网络环境包含多种网络设备,包括路由器、交换机、防火墙等。这些设备分别采用SNMP、CMIP、NetFlow等协议进行数据采集。为了实现对这些设备的统一管理,企业选择了NNSMS作为网络管理系统。
通过NNSMS的多协议支持机制,企业实现了以下功能:
对不同协议的数据进行统一采集、存储和分析。
实现对网络设备的统一监控和管理。
为企业提供了全面、准确的网络数据。
五、总结
NNSMS的多协议支持机制为网络管理系统带来了诸多优势,降低了开发成本,提高了系统性能和可扩展性。在当今多协议网络环境下,NNSMS成为了网络管理领域的佼佼者。
猜你喜欢:云原生可观测性